And here's the card I made that inspired the sketch. I know I saw a card like this on the Internet somewhere and unfortunately, I did not record the maker. My new resolution is to always make note of where I steal....er...borrow....or beg these card ideas. There's so much out there on a daily basis, it is difficult to remember where you saw what. I made this card for my stepson's upcoming 49th birthday. Ohmygosh, did I just say my stepson will be 49? YIKES!!! Anyway, he and his father are car nuts and Scott recently acquired a used Mercedes so we thought this stamp would be fabulous for his card. The papers are all from the October Simon Says Card Kit called Forever and Always. The stamp is from B Line Designs. Thanks for looking and a big thanks especially if you forgive me and play along.
